Comparable Facts

Compare Research College of Nursing in Kansas City, MO with University of Management and Technology in Arlington, VA on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.

University of Management and Technology is larger than Research College of Nursing based on total student enrollment (979 students vs. 205 students)

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io

  • Research College of Nursing is located in Kansas City, MO (Large City setting); University of Management and Technology is in Arlington, VA (Midsize City setting).
  • Research College of Nursing is a private, for-profit 4-year institution. University of Management and Technology is a private, for-profit 4-year institution.
  • Student-to-faculty ratio: Research College of Nursing 7:1; University of Management and Technology 15:1.

Research College of Nursing vs. University of Management and Technology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Research College of Nursing or University of Management and Technology?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).

  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Research College of Nursing are 21.2% lower than at University of Management and Technology ($5,480 vs. $6,954).
  • Research College of Nursing is 193.9% more expensive for in-state tuition than University of Management and Technology (about $18,320 more per year; $27,770.00 vs. $9,450.00).
  • Out-of-state tuition is 193.9% higher at Research College of Nursing than at University of Management and Technology (about $18,320 more per year; $27,770.00 vs. $9,450.00).
  • The same share of students receive grant aid at Research College of Nursing as at University of Management and Technology (0% vs. 0%).
